Output eacc6dd6f751ec984aecbcd7b83cd10d48332f798e24d58ccb1a12e36c84c533:7

value
63208874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e3e59e5af48a46387fd333eb5985a1f83bd499 OP_EQUAL
address
MTDXpTrtJXFE1cRKs2Ledg4s1gFyN2DwB2
transaction
eacc6dd6f751ec984aecbcd7b83cd10d48332f798e24d58ccb1a12e36c84c533
spent
true